What Is PESO License for Liquid Carbon Dioxide?
The PESO License for Liquid Carbon Dioxide refers to an official permit necessary for storing and handling liquid carbon dioxide safely in India.
It is issued by the Petroleum & Explosives Safety Organization (PESO. The license is essential in ensuring adherence to industrial safety and compliance measures.
It is mandatory for the manufacturers and suppliers of gases who handle pressurized carbon dioxide in their industries.
Important information includes:
- A compulsory license for storing and handling of liquid CO₂
- Compliance with the Indian safety measures and regulations
- Before beginning any commercial gas activities
- Issued after a verification process conducted by PESO officials
Some of the products it covers are:
- Liquid carbon dioxide cylinders
- Industrial liquid carbon dioxide storage tanks
- Gas filling and distribution tanks
The PESO License for Liquid Carbon Dioxide is important in ensuring the highest safety standards are maintained during manufacturing and storage processes.
This helps prevent hazards like leakages, explosions, or other accidents from happening. It also ensures quality and safety of the product.

Who Needs PESO License for Liquid Carbon Dioxide?
The PESO License for Liquid Carbon Dioxide is needed by any company that deals with liquid carbon dioxide in any form such as manufacturing, supplying, exporting, or importing it. Here are some examples of who needs this license:
- Manufacturers: Manufacturers need the license to produce and store liquid CO₂ according to the safety rules.
- Suppliers: Suppliers need it to sell their liquid CO₂ cylinders to customers.
- Exporters: Exporters need this license to export CO₂ cylinders abroad following international regulations.
- Importers: Importers need the license to import liquid CO₂ cylinders to India safely and legally.
Hence, all companies involved in dealing with liquid CO₂ need to obtain a PESO License for Liquid Carbon Dioxide. Without this license, companies would be fined or penalized.
Documentation Needed for PESO License for Liquid Carbon Dioxide
In order to acquire the PESO License for Liquid Carbon Dioxide, certain documentation must be prepared to maintain the required safety standards. These documents are used by the authorities to confirm the legitimacy and safety of the company.
- Certificate of registration of the company showing its identity and legitimacy
- Plant layout and design plan for storage
- Information regarding the product, including details about gas specification and applications
- Safety data sheets along with risk assessments
- Test results for equipment and cylinders used for storage
- Quality check documentation to maintain safety standards during manufacturing
- No objection certificates from the local authorities
It is imperative that these documents be thoroughly verified before issuing any license. Hence, correct and current documentation is extremely necessary.
Step-by-Step Process for PESO License for Liquid Carbon Dioxide
The license for liquid carbon dioxide is approved by following certain steps. Every step aims at ensuring safety, compliance, and appropriate verification of facilities.
1. Documents Collection
- The first step involves preparation of relevant documents such as those related to company registration, plant design, and safety assessments. All the data should be correct and up-to-date.
2. Application Submission
- The second step involves submission of application forms and documents to the PESO office. It may be done either via the internet or at an official office.
3. Technical Assessment
- Afterward, the submitted documentation is assessed by PESO officers. They ensure compliance with all relevant safety and industrial rules and regulations.
4. Site Inspection
- Site inspection of the facilities is done in order to examine the safety of equipment involved. This is aimed at ensuring their compliance with established safety standards.
5. Testing for Non-Conformity
- Testing and checking for non-conformity is done for relevant facilities. Any discovered non-conformity must be sorted out prior to license approval.
6. Final Approval
- Finally, when everything is found in order, the PESO license is issued. With that license in hand, business activities become legal.
PESO License for Liquid Carbon Dioxide – Timeline, Cost & Renewal
| Category | Details |
| Processing Time | 30–60 days on average, depending on document completeness and inspection scheduling. |
| Testing Period | Safety testing takes around 1–2 weeks after the site visit. |
| Cost | Fees vary based on company size, storage capacity, and application type. |
| Validity | License is issued for a fixed period and must be renewed before expiry. |
| Renewal Process | Renewal requires updated safety documents and inspection report before expiry date. |
| Delay Prevention Tips | Submit complete documents, ensure safety compliance, and respond quickly to PESO queries. |
